Lucas Czech is a Postdoctoral researcher at the University of Copenhagen specializing in population genetics. His research encompasses the generation of population genetic statistics through advanced sequencing techniques. Over the past five years, Czech has collaborated extensively within Europe and America, contributing valuable insights to the field of genetic research. His recent publication addresses the analysis of population genetic data, highlighting the significance of collaborative efforts in producing high-quality research outputs. With a focus on statistical methodologies and applied genetic research, Czech continually seeks to expand his expertise and impact in the scientific community.
